From my experience I would Be VERY careful about those "extended warranties" as some retailers use "scare tactics" to get you to buy those warranties. BIG COMMISSIONS involved here.

Check in your yellow pages and contact an IBM service dept, you may find that if anything goes wrong you can take it there and NOT have to send it away.

Do some checking, don't believe what the sales person tells you.
